What owners are reporting 6 most recent

brakes · 35,000 mi · filed 12/20/2019

At low speeds the brake pedal becomes very slugs if pressed quickly for sudden stop, wile the truck continues to travel for a short distance.

brakes · filed 12/13/2023

When driving at lower speeds the vehicle is hard to stop. I have to press the brakes down hard to get it to stop. A message will usually come up saying to service the brake assist but no maintenance lights show up. brakes · filed 10/27/2021

The brake assist function has been very sketchy and coming on unexpectedly and the emergency braking when reversing is malfunctioning and coming on unexpectedly with no need in error in a very hard/ fast stop.
